Latest deals
Insights
When to book
FAQs
Reviews
Price Alerts

Cheap flights from Cape Town to Porto from R12 506

This is the cheapest return flight price found by a momondo user in the last 72 hours by searching for a flight from Cape Town to Porto departing on 25/5. Fares may change, and may not be available for all flights or travel dates. Click the price to refresh the search for this deal.
1 adult
0 bags

Discover deals from 900+ travel sites with momondo.

Save money when you book flights with momondo

Big names, great deals

Big names, great deals

Search 100s of travel sites to compare prices.

Filter for what you want

Filter for what you want

Free Wi-Fi? Stopover? Instantly customise your results.

Trusted and free

Trusted and free

We’re completely free to use - no hidden charges or fees.

Price Alerts

Price Alerts

Not ready to book? to track prices.

Find the cheapest flights from Cape Town to Porto

Cheap return flights

KAYAK's recommended return flight deals from the most popular airlines that fly from Cape Town to Porto.
 Logo
0:30 - 7:50CPT-OPO
32h 20m2 stops
 Logo
16:00 - 14:00OPO-CPT
21h 00m2 stops
R12 506
Find Deal
Sun, May 25 - Mon, Jun 2
 Logo
0:30 - 7:50CPT-OPO
32h 20m2 stops
 Logo
11:00 - 14:00OPO-CPT
26h 00m2 stops
R12 564
Find Deal
Sun, May 25 - Mon, Jun 2
 Logo
0:30 - 7:50CPT-OPO
32h 20m2 stops
 Logo
11:00 - 14:00OPO-CPT
26h 00m2 stops
R12 641
Find Deal
Sun, May 25 - Mon, Jun 2
KLM Logo
18:25 - 17:55CPT-OPO
24h 30m2 stops
KLM Logo
16:20 - 21:25OPO-CPT
28h 05m1 stop
R13 680KLM
Find Deal
Mon, May 26 - Mon, Jun 2
KLM Logo
18:25 - 17:55CPT-OPO
24h 30m2 stops
KLM Logo
16:20 - 21:25OPO-CPT
28h 05m1 stop
R13 757KLM
Find Deal
Mon, May 26 - Mon, Jun 2
Air France Logo
23:15 - 20:35CPT-OPO
22h 20m2 stops
Air France Logo
16:20 - 12:40OPO-CPT
19h 20m2 stops
R15 873Air France
Find Deal
Fri, May 23 - Fri, May 30
Turkish Airlines Logo
16:35 - 9:50CPT-OPO
18h 15m1 stop
Turkish Airlines Logo
16:50 - 11:50OPO-CPT
18h 00m1 stop
R18 490Turkish Airlines
Find Deal
Mon, Sep 15 - Tue, Sep 30
Turkish Airlines Logo
16:35 - 15:50CPT-OPO
24h 15m1 stop
Turkish Airlines Logo
16:50 - 11:50OPO-CPT
18h 00m1 stop
R21 684Turkish Airlines
Find Deal
Tue, May 13 - Tue, Jun 17
SWISS Logo
19:00 - 17:20CPT-OPO
23h 20m1 stop
SWISS Logo
8:40 - 16:45OPO-CPT
31h 05m2 stops
R28 706SWISS
Find Deal
Thu, May 8 - Wed, Jul 23
SWISS Logo
11:05 - 11:30CPT-OPO
25h 25m2 stops
SWISS Logo
3:05 - 16:45OPO-CPT
36h 40m2 stops
R35 479SWISS
Find Deal
Tue, Jun 24 - Sat, Jul 12

SWISS flights from Cape Town to Porto

Our best SWISS deals on Cape Town to Porto flight tickets
SWISS
May 8
CPT19:00Cape Town Intl
23h 20m
1 stop
OPO17:20Porto
Jul 23
OPO8:40Porto
31h 05m
2 stops
CPT16:45Cape Town Intl
R28 706
Find similar
SWISS
Jun 24
CPT11:05Cape Town Intl
25h 25m
2 stops
OPO11:30Porto
Jul 12
OPO3:05Porto
36h 40m
2 stops
CPT16:45Cape Town Intl
R35 479
Find similar
SWISS
Apr 26
CPT14:40Cape Town Intl
24h 05m
3 stops
OPO13:45Porto
May 3
OPO19:20Porto
41h 05m
2 stops
CPT13:25Cape Town Intl
R46 888
Find similar

KLM flights from Cape Town to Porto

Our best KLM deals on Cape Town to Porto flight tickets
KLM
May 26
CPT18:25Cape Town Intl
24h 30m
2 stops
OPO17:55Porto
Jun 2
OPO16:20Porto
28h 05m
1 stop
CPT21:25Cape Town Intl
R13 680
Find similar
KLM
May 26
CPT18:25Cape Town Intl
24h 30m
2 stops
OPO17:55Porto
Jun 2
OPO16:20Porto
28h 05m
1 stop
CPT21:25Cape Town Intl
R13 757
Find similar
KLM
May 26
CPT18:25Cape Town Intl
24h 30m
2 stops
OPO17:55Porto
Jun 2
OPO17:30Porto
26h 55m
1 stop
CPT21:25Cape Town Intl
R13 872
Find similar

See travel insights to Porto from

How to get the cheapest flight ticket from Cape Town to Porto

Look no further. We've gone through all the searches for this route on momondo so you have the important information and insights to find the cheapest flight ticket for your trip

What is the cheapest month to fly to Porto?

The month of November is, on average, the cheapest month to fly to Porto from Cape Town, with most prices found around R10 813. The month of January is another great option to travel to Porto, with average flight prices from Cape Town averaging around R10 967.

What is the cheapest day to depart on your flight to Porto?

On average, the least expensive day to fly to Porto from Cape Town is on a Monday. momondo users have found tickets for Monday departures for as low as R14 594. However, this price may fluctuate depending on the airline, the season, and holidays. When flying out on a Saturday, the most expensive travel day of the week, you can expect to see flight prices from Cape Town to Porto for around R18 441.

What is the cheapest time of day to depart on your flight to Porto?

Our data shows that the cheapest Cape Town to Porto flights are usually those with departure times in the morning. Our users have found flights to Porto in the morning for as low as R13 442. At midday is when there is more demand to fly to Porto, so prices are often more expensive at around R19 240 per ticket.

How far in advance should I book a flight to Porto?

You are more likely to see cheaper flights to Porto from Cape Town when booking 15 weeks ahead of your departure date. In general, you can expect to find flights to Porto for around R15 770 when searching 15 weeks out.However, flight prices might be lower outside of this timeframe. For example, people recently found flights to Porto from Cape Town for as low as R12 737 on momondo.

How have Cape Town to Porto flight prices changed over time?

As of April 2025, prices for Cape Town to Porto flights are approximately 8% more expensive when compared to flights at the same time last year.

When to book flights from Cape Town to Porto

Are you open to changing your travel dates? Check out the ideal times to fly from Cape Town to Porto according to our flight data. Find out which month and days have the cheapest flights.
Estimated return price

Cheap Cape Town to Porto (CPT to OPO) flight deals and tips

Find info about flight duration, direct flights, and airports for your flight from Cape Town to Porto

Best price found

R12 506

Fastest flight time

17h 35m

Direct flights

None

Airports in Porto

1 airport
The best flight deal from Cape Town to Porto found on momondo in the last 72 hours is R12 506
The fastest flight from Cape Town to Porto takes 17h 35m
There are no direct flights from Cape Town to Porto. Popular non-direct route for this connection is Cape Town Intl Airport - Porto Airport.
There is 1 airport near Porto: Porto (OPO)

  • How far is Cape Town Intl to Porto by plane?

    Porto is 8790,4 km away from Cape Town Intl. Typically, this will take 17h 35m by plane in normal conditions.

  • When did momondo last update prices for flights from Cape Town Intl Airport to Porto Airport?

    Prices for flights from Cape Town Intl Airport to Porto Airport were last updated today.

  • How many operators does momondo search for flights from Cape Town Intl Airport to Porto Airport?

  • How old do you have to be to fly from Cape Town Intl Airport to Porto Airport?

    The minimum age for a child to fly alone is five, but airlines that offer an unaccompanied minor (UNMR) service may have their own age limitations. Flight duration, scheduling, and stopovers are among the considerations that may influence age limits. We recommend that you double-check with the airline you are booking with for travel from Cape Town Intl Airport to Porto Airport.

  • What documentation or ID do you need to fly to Porto Airport?

    The travel and health documents you'll need for your trip to Porto Airport may differ based on your itinerary and personal situation. Typically, you should have several documents on hand, such as a national ID card or driver's licence and a passport that is valid for six months after your intended arrival at Porto Airport. It is always advisable to seek advice from your airline or a trusted third party, such as IATA.

  • What is the most popular airline from Cape Town to Porto?


Best airlines flying from Cape Town to Porto

Compare and see reviews for airlines that fly from Cape Town to Porto with momondo
Airline
Rating
Free Cancellation
Price
SWISSPriceFrom R8 137Free CancellationRating
7,5
1 575 reviews
Search SWISS flights
LufthansaPriceFrom R10 867Free CancellationRating
6,7
6 992 reviews
Search Lufthansa flights
KLMPriceFrom R11 297Free CancellationRating
7,8
1 321 reviews
Search KLM flights
Turkish AirlinesPriceFrom R13 241Free CancellationRating
7,3
3 756 reviews
Search Turkish Airlines flights
EmiratesPriceFrom R18 185Free CancellationRating
8,0
3 197 reviews
Search Emirates flights

Travelling to a place near Porto?

Book flights to Porto if you plan to visit one of these locations
Coimbra
Vila Nova de Gaia
Braga
Viseu
Guimarães
Aveiro
Espinho
Lamego

Why use momondo?

Why should I use momondo to find a flight deal from Cape Town to Porto?

To find the flight that best suits your needs, momondo gathers a range of flights from a large pool of different airlines and agents; you can then use our insights and filters to find and book the right flight to Porto from Cape Town.

Can I find flights from Cape Town to Porto with flexible booking policies on momondo?

Yes. All flights to Porto from Cape Town on momondo can be compared and filtered by various policies on offer, including flexible booking.

How can momondo help me find flights from Cape Town to Porto?

Once all potential Cape Town to Porto flight options are in front of you, momondo lets you sort and filter flights based on preferences such as airline, price and flight times amongst many other options.

I’m not ready to book a flight from Cape Town to Porto right now. Can momondo alert me if prices change?

Yes momondo offers price alerts on flights to Porto from Cape Town. After performing a search on this page you should be able to see the price alert set up feature. Simply provide a valid email address and momondo will instantly alert you when prices change.


An easier way to manage your Porto trip

We make it super easy to schedule, organise and travel with friends or family. Trips is free – and available to use no matter where you book.

Get notified when prices go down

Daily price changes in your inbox - only with Price Alerts.
1 adult
From?
To?
Thu 17/4
Thu 24/4

Find better results for your trip to Portugal